Understanding the Core Mechanics and Risk Factors
At its heart, aviator is a game of escalating risk. The longer the airplane remains in flight, the higher the multiplier, and consequently, the greater the potential winnings. However, this increased reward comes with a proportionally higher risk of the plane flying away, causing the player to lose their stake. This fundamental principle dictates the core strategy: determine a risk tolerance and cash out before the multiplier becomes too tempting and the possibility of a crash looms large. Understanding the random number generator (RNG) that governs the plane’s flight is vital, even though its inner workings are opaque. The RNG ensures that each flight is independent, meaning past results have no bearing on the outcome of future flights. This non-linearity challenges players to abandon the illusion of patterns and focus on independent decision-making.

The Martingale and Anti-Martingale Systems
Two popular betting systems frequently employed in aviator are the Martingale and Anti-Martingale strategies. The Martingale involves doubling your bet after each loss, aiming to recover previous losses with a single win. While seemingly foolproof, this system requires a substantial bankroll to withstand prolonged losing streaks and can quickly lead to reaching the table's bet limit. The Anti-Martingale, conversely, entails increasing your bet after each win. This strategy capitalizes on winning streaks but can quickly deplete your bankroll during periods of successive losses. Both systems carry inherent risks and require careful consideration, and are not universally recommended as foolproof strategies. Understanding their limitations and adapting them to your individual risk tolerance is paramount.
